Yes, Amity School of Communication (ASCO) accepts Common Admission Test score for admission to its Master of Business Administration program. Candidates qualifying Common Admission Test with a percentile of 75 or above are eligible to go through the selection process at Amity School of Communication. Along with Common Admission Test, Amity School of Communication also accepts other entrance exams like GMAT, NMAT, and MAT.
